The document is an Asset Purchase Agreement, designed for transactions between a seller and a buyer seeking to acquire a business's assets. It outlines the terms for the purchase of specific assets, including equipment, inventory, and goodwill, while detailing any liabilities assumed by the buyer. The agreement specifies key features such as the purchase price allocation, payment schedule, and conditions of closing, emphasizing the importance of preserving business operations prior to closing.
